John Preston
|
16a2d4ec96
|
Fix wrong "Webview process crashed." message.
|
2024-01-04 18:50:47 +04:00 |
|
Ilya Fedin
|
d63ebbe62c
|
Handle webview crash
|
2023-12-23 19:12:17 +00:00 |
|
John Preston
|
396c229a4d
|
Improve Ui::Text::String features.
|
2023-10-04 22:24:25 +04:00 |
|
John Preston
|
d5b429e910
|
Update API scheme to layer 164.
|
2023-09-22 09:43:31 +04:00 |
|
John Preston
|
229f7a2c15
|
Handle background / title colors in web-apps.
|
2023-09-12 21:01:12 +04:00 |
|
John Preston
|
fbd8abc1c6
|
Start main menu bots.
|
2023-09-12 21:01:12 +04:00 |
|
John Preston
|
2fb7bdc803
|
Skip refocus InputField::Inner if field unfocused.
I hope this fixes #26223.
|
2023-05-24 21:22:26 +04:00 |
|
John Preston
|
65afa2c402
|
Detach ComposeControls from SessionController.
|
2023-05-17 15:51:52 +04:00 |
|
Ilya Fedin
|
d52cabb386
|
Update to the new WebKitGTK 6.0 API
|
2023-04-02 17:19:15 +04:00 |
|
Ilya Fedin
|
68ad56db79
|
Use QtWaylandCompositor for webview embedding on Linux
|
2022-11-01 19:33:46 +04:00 |
|
John Preston
|
f7885da7dd
|
Support additional saved payment methods.
|
2022-07-26 20:12:14 +03:00 |
|
John Preston
|
bb251627a9
|
Support additional payment methods.
|
2022-07-26 20:12:12 +03:00 |
|
John Preston
|
66e9c5ef16
|
Allow HiddenUrlClickHandler to work in a payment form.
|
2022-06-20 17:14:14 +04:00 |
|
John Preston
|
b7259615a7
|
Request terms acceptance for recurring payments.
|
2022-06-01 11:59:14 +04:00 |
|
John Preston
|
df533f2efe
|
Don't use WebView embed in Windows before 8.1.
|
2022-04-20 11:43:53 +04:00 |
|
John Preston
|
d4cb56a73d
|
Custom scroll bar in WebKit / Chromium.
|
2022-04-12 23:01:37 +04:00 |
|
John Preston
|
d15ff46eb4
|
Fix webview initialization on GCC.
|
2022-04-08 23:15:37 +04:00 |
|
John Preston
|
73c5988e7e
|
Allow opening external pages from attach bots.
|
2022-04-06 10:55:05 +04:00 |
|
John Preston
|
aed1904b4c
|
Support theming for webview-s (payments, attach).
|
2022-03-30 12:23:05 +04:00 |
|
John Preston
|
4ef550da9b
|
Hide webview while showing a box in payments.
|
2021-09-30 14:53:18 +04:00 |
|
John Preston
|
8608d8aa4d
|
Crash Fix: Destroy WebView before the container.
|
2021-06-29 11:07:47 +03:00 |
|
John Preston
|
34c5ce16d0
|
Fix contract violation in shutdown with webview.
|
2021-04-13 16:52:40 +04:00 |
|
John Preston
|
e52f947f98
|
Improve webview progress style.
|
2021-04-13 16:38:38 +04:00 |
|
John Preston
|
40e46e8480
|
Hide webview progress instantly.
|
2021-04-13 15:37:25 +04:00 |
|
John Preston
|
73c63cb2c7
|
Hide payments webview progress when destroying.
|
2021-04-13 14:05:31 +04:00 |
|
John Preston
|
0ead0879d7
|
Support blocking progress in payment panel.
|
2021-04-12 19:24:36 +04:00 |
|
John Preston
|
35ff621b5b
|
Show toast on successfull payment.
|
2021-04-12 12:50:31 +04:00 |
|
John Preston
|
8c7217ad56
|
Fix build on macOS.
|
2021-04-06 18:53:03 +04:00 |
|
John Preston
|
d40687adb8
|
Remove testing code.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
ee098d00ad
|
Add better error reporting to payments.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
e106bd143e
|
Add a warning once per bot on payment.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
62684ab9bb
|
Warn before closing payment panel.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
b6c86fd298
|
Add nice tips buttons.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
b1c122a260
|
Add ' (Test)' to checkout panel titles.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
491ec2db7f
|
Always show footer in webview in payments.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
7cbe158d00
|
Update API scheme.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
1cc1f380d0
|
Implement a nice money input field.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
663db64688
|
Allow saving and using saved credentials.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
619f70ab22
|
Improve design of shipping option selection.
|
2021-04-06 18:41:16 +04:00 |
|
John Preston
|
8cac76931e
|
Support adding tips in payments.
|
2021-04-06 18:41:15 +04:00 |
|
John Preston
|
c7a1771dec
|
Simple receipt viewing.
|
2021-04-06 18:41:15 +04:00 |
|
John Preston
|
47fdef1e38
|
Improve checkout information / card page design.
|
2021-04-06 18:41:15 +04:00 |
|
John Preston
|
fafea73ea7
|
Improve checkout main page design.
|
2021-04-06 18:41:15 +04:00 |
|
John Preston
|
56031a6402
|
Handle native / non-native payment methods (same way).
|
2021-04-06 18:41:15 +04:00 |
|
John Preston
|
5e4bc200c2
|
Support entering card details natively.
|
2021-04-06 18:41:15 +04:00 |
|
John Preston
|
212497413c
|
Show some payment errors, focus fields.
|
2021-04-06 18:41:15 +04:00 |
|
John Preston
|
0d44736575
|
First full-featured version of payments, no design.
|
2021-04-06 18:41:15 +04:00 |
|
John Preston
|
4c707bff29
|
Start proper payments processing.
|
2021-04-06 18:41:15 +04:00 |
|